Book excerpt: Arctic landscapes are more susceptible to stronger and earlier impacts from climate change than are the mid-latitudes. The potential for the vast amount of carbon that has been stored in permafrost soils (1400-1850 Pg, Grosse et. al, 2011) for thousands of years to be mobilized due permafrost degradation and thermokarst development in response to climate change is poorly understood and of global importance. With the prevalence of thermokarst lakes in arctic regions, thaw beneath these lakes in response to a changing climate will be an important pathway for carbon and methane release into the atmosphere. Using a lake ice regime classification based on spaceborne synthetic aperture radar over a 25-year time period, we can begin to decipher the trends in bedfast ice extent in response to differing environmental parameters and ambient conditions. Trends in the distribution of bedfast ice extent for lakes in the 0-60% bedfast ice interval emerged by applying a robust probability density function statistical methodological technique. Simple linear regression analysis revealed statistically significant slopes and good model performance in the vulnerable sub-population of lakes that are floating ice across the Inner and Outer Coastal Plains of the North Slope. Using transient electromagnetic soundings on 33 lakes, we can characterize the electrical resistivity profiles of lakes of different ice regimes. In general, bedfast ice regime lakes had the most resistive profile corresponding to little to no permafrost thaw and floating ice lakes had the least resistive profiles corresponding to associated permafrost thaw beneath them. Transitional ice lake profiles were more closely related to floating ice lake profiles than bedfast ice. In a case study of eleven transitional ice lakes in the Barrow region, we find there exists a linear relationship between the proportion of time a lake has been under floating ice conditions and the depth of the talik. Combining lake initiation age, thermal modeling using available ground material properties, and geophysical investigations we are able to independently determine talik thickness across transects of a lake with different lake shore expansion rates. Both thermal modeling and geophysical methods showed deeper talik development than previous modeling studies on the Alaskan coastal plain. The products of this work include past, present, and projected distribution of bedfast ice regime lakes in the study areas across the Alaskan North Slope and permafrost thaw associated with the change in ice regime. These results, when coupled to the permafrost-water-climate system, greatly increase our understanding of how lake rich arctic regions are responding in response to changing ambient weather conditions. This is of particular importance for expanses of lowland Alaska, Canada, and Siberia where arctic amplification has been severe and expected to continue.

Book excerpt: Once ice-bound, difficult to access, and largely ignored by the rest of the world, the Arctic is now front and center in the midst of many important questions facing the world today. Our daily weather, what we eat, and coastal flooding are all interconnected with the future of the Arctic. The year 2012 was an astounding year for Arctic change. The summer sea ice volume smashed previous records, losing approximately 75 percent of its value since 1980 and half of its areal coverage. Multiple records were also broken when 97 percent of Greenland's surface experienced melt conditions in 2012, the largest melt extent in the satellite era. Receding ice caps in Arctic Canada are now exposing land surfaces that have been continuously ice covered for more than 40,000 years. What happens in the Arctic has far-reaching implications around the world. Loss of snow and ice exacerbates climate change and is the largest contributor to expected global sea level rise during the next century. Ten percent of the world's fish catches comes from Arctic and sub-Arctic waters. The U.S. Geological Survey estimated that up to 13 percent of the world's remaining oil reserves are in the Arctic. The geologic history of the Arctic may hold vital clues about massive volcanic eruptions and the consequent release of massive amount of coal fly ash that is thought to have caused mass extinctions in the distant past. Book excerpt: U.S. Arctic waters north of the Bering Strait and west of the Canadian border encompass a vast area that is usually ice covered for much of the year, but is increasingly experiencing longer periods and larger areas of open water due to climate change. Sparsely inhabited with a wide variety of ecosystems found nowhere else, this region is vulnerable to damage from human activities. As oil and gas, shipping, and tourism activities increase, the possibilities of an oil spill also increase. How can we best prepare to respond to such an event in this challenging environment? When the International Heat Flow Committee (as it was first called), IHFC, was formed in 1963 at the San Francisco International Union of Geodesy and Geophysics with Francis Birch as its first Chairman, the principal purpose was to stimulate work in the basic aspects of geothermics, particularly the measurement of terrestrial heat-flow density (HFD) in what were then the 'geothermally underdeveloped' areas of the world. In this, the IHFC was remarkably successful. By the beginning of the second decade of our existence, interest in the economic aspects of geothermics was increasing at a rapid pace and the IHFC served as a conduit for all aspects of geothermics and, moreover, became the group responsi ble for collecting data on all types of HFD measurements. Increasing temperatures, ocean warming and acidification, severe droughts, wildfires, altered precipitation patterns, melting glaciers, rising sea levels and amplification of extreme weather events have direct implications for our food systems. While the impacts of such environmental factors on food security are well known, the effects on food safety receive less attention. The purpose of Climate change: Unpacking the burden on food safety is to identify and attempt to quantify some current and anticipated food safety issues that are associated with climate change. The food safety hazards considered in the publication are foodborne pathogens and parasites, harmful algal blooms, pesticides, mycotoxins and heavy metals with emphasis on methylmercury.
